Mn2SiSe4 is a manganese silicate selenide compound that belongs to the family of transition metal chalcogenides, materials combining transition metals with selenium and silicon. This is primarily a research and developmental material studied for its semiconducting and optoelectronic properties rather than a conventional engineering alloy; potential applications include thermoelectric devices, photovoltaic systems, and specialty electronic components where its band gap and thermal transport characteristics are exploited.
